Ramsy Unruh was ordained Sept. 28 at Community Fellowship Church, Newton, Man., with conference pastor Keith Poysti leading the service. Ramsy has served as senior pastor at Community Fellowship Church for five years. He and his wife Shannon have three children.

Gateway Christian Fellowship, St. Catharines, Ont., welcomed Steve Reimer as half-time pastoral intern working with youth and student ministries. A teacher in the public school system, Steve will continue to teach part-time. Steve and his wife Jessica have 2 boys, Isaac and Evan. Leah Hageman-Vermeulen served as director of the Lenz (drop-in ministry for local youth) for more than 4 years before stepping down at the end of August.

Yohannes Engida began serving Bethel Evangelical Christian Assembly, Winnipeg, as senior pastor this summer. He previously served as associate pastor under Tesfa Chutta who resigned but remains on the leadership team. Yohannes and his wife Mihiret have one child.

Victor Kliewer stepped down from lead pastor to half-time associate pastor of German and caregiving ministries at Elmwood MB Church, Winnipeg, after 3 years of faithful service with his wife Val. Terry Sawatsky was installed and blessed as lead pastor Sept. 14. Terry previously served as associate pastor at Elmwood. Terry and his wife Cathy have one daughter.

Columbia Bible College, Abbotsford, B.C. added staff to their advancement team. Paul Loewen, who has pastored in several provinces and sits on the CCMBC executive board joined the church and donor relations team. Vern Heidebrecht is working one day a week with church and donor relations, transcending the challenges of Parkinson’s disease. Vern is a former board chair for CBC and pastor emeritus for Northview Community Church.

The board of Family Life Network in Winnipeg appointed Claude Pratte as executive director. Previous to 2 years at FLN as director of church relations and interim director, Claude served 27 years as a pastor in Baptist and Mennonite Brethren churches. He and his wife Vivian have 3 grown sons.

Nelson Kraybill, president of Associated Mennonite Biblical Seminary, announced his intent to step down from the seminary in summer 2009. Coming to the seminary with experience as a pastor, scholar, and mission worker, Nelson began as president in 1997.

Merv Boschman concluded his service as executive minister of the Alberta MB conference at the end of September. Over the past five years, Merv and his wife Carol worked with pastors, church leaders, and congregants around the province. They are planning to move back to B.C.

Andrea Geiser was appointed coordinator of YAMEN! The joint Mennonite World Conference and MCC program builds church-to-church relationships and strengthens the global Anabaptist church by facilitating a volunteer exchange for young adults from outside North America to serve outside of North America.
